用同一IP地址实现多域名对应多个站点
Win2000 Server和NT Server的IIS使用三个参数来决定将哪个网站的数据传送给浏览器 IP地址主机名和TCP端口。
当我们在浏览器的URL栏输入xxx.vicp.net 举例而已不是色情网站 浏览器就会查询xxx.vicp.net的IP地址于是我们的服务器会概述它你的IP地址然后浏览器将URL的数据打包传递到查询到的IP地址的80端口默认的Web服务端口 如果你的Web服务不使用80端口的话你需要告诉你的朋友在域名后面加上一个冒号和端口的数值就像这样 xxx.vicp.net:8080。你的Web服务器将收到这个URL请求然后根据数据包中标示的目的地地址你的Internet IP 、 TCP端口号和URL中的主机名判断需要读取哪个主目录下的文件。
下面我们一步一步说明实际的配置
我假设你申请了两个域名: 1.vicp.net和2.vicp.net以下步骤将让用户访问1.vicp.net的时候读取c:\www1下的网站访问2.vicp.net的时候读取
C:\www2的网站而使用1.vicp.net:8080、 2.vicp.net:8080或直接使用ip地址访问不带端口号的情况则读取C:\www 8080的网站。 以上的路径和主机名称、端口号可以根据需要自行改变。
1、首先我们建立三个测试目录在C盘建立 www 1,www 2,www 8080三个目录然后在三个目录下分别拷贝三个不同的htm文件把他们改为Default.htm
2、打开Intenet服务管理器你会看到一个名字为默认站点得网站处于安全原因我简易你先把它关掉不要删除否则重新建立会非常麻烦 点击“默认Web站点”按鼠标右键或在工具栏点击停止键。这时别人访问你的域名或IP地址则会出错不用担心继续下一步。
3、点击你的计算机名按鼠标右键选择“新建” -〉 “Web站点” Win2000会弹出一个网站向导 NT则弹出一个对话框 NT的内容比2000小一些所以以下全部以2000为例。按下一步填写网站的说明这仅仅是说明将会出现在Internt服务管理器的界面中标示你得网站随便填点什么就行我喜欢使用域名来标示网站所以填上1.vicp.net,按“下一步” 。
4、在“输入Web站点使用的ip地址”栏选择“全部未分配” 既保持默认不动这样不管是使用你的内部IP地址还是使用外部Internet IP地址都可以访问到这个网站 即使你的外部IP地址变化了也没有问题。千万不要选择你的外部IP地址否则每次拨号后你都需要改变网站的IP这样“花生壳”带来的方便性就荡然无存了。 “此Web站点使用到的TCP端口”设置保持不动即默然的80。然后在“此站点的主机头”栏填写 1.vicp.net。 SSL端口保持空这个设置我以后再说。按“下一步” 。
5、在“路径”栏输入c:\www 1或按“浏览”键选择网站所在的目录。按下一步。
6、访问权限部分不做任何修改。按“下一步”
7、好了按“完成” 这时你应该看到Internet服务管理器中你的计算机名下多了一个1.vicp.net。
8、打开浏览器在url栏中输入1.vicp.net你应该能够看到C:\www1目录下的Default.htm页面。如果由问题请检查该目录下是否由Default.htm。以及你刚才操作是否正确。检查的方法如下在你得网站名称上按鼠标右键弹出网站属性页面暂时不要管其它设置检查在“Web站点”下的IP地址端口按“高级”键查看“主机头名” 退出高级设置对话框点击主目录查看“本地路径” 点击“文档”查看默认文档是不是“Default.htm” 。在不行打电话请我上门服务报销来回车费每小时工程费200. . .US$
好了已经设置好一个网站不过这时使用2.vicp.net和ip地址访问还是有问题别灰心下面我们设置2.vicp.net。
其实很简单重复3-7步不过是1.vicp.net改成2.vicp.net将c:\www1改成C:\www 2而已。举一反三相信你会很快上手不过别聪明过头了我知道你会试8080的不过你会碰壁的。
下面我们需要建立第三个网站这个网站不管你使用IP地址、还是上述域名中的任何一个加8080的端口号都能访问。
重复3-7步但是在第4步不要重复不要填写此站点的主机头” 该栏必须留空。
好了这个时候如果你使用I P地址访问则会看到www 8080目录的得Default.htm不过使用1.vicp.net或2.vicp.net则看到www1或www2很神奇吧。不过使用1.vicp.net:8080、2.vicp.net:8080或ip地址加8080端口号则出错。这很正常见以下步骤
9、在第三个网站上按鼠标右键选择“属性” 弹出网站的属性对话框按“高级”弹出网站的高级属性对话框 嘿嘿我们已经玩得很高级了 。在“此站点由多个标识”下面的列表中你会看到一项内容 IP地址全部未分配端口 80主机头名空。然后按“添加” 弹出“高级站点标识”对话框。在“TCP端口”中填写8080保持“IP地址”为全部未分配 “主机头名”为空按“确定” 再“确定” 再“确定” 。然后打开浏览器输入1.vicp.net:8080确定网站工作正常。
今天早上相比很多网友和一样收到来自Linode的庆祝18周年的邮件信息。和往年一样,他们会回顾在过去一年中的成绩,以及在未来准备改进的地方。虽然目前Linode商家没有提供以前JP1优化线路的机房,但是人家一直跟随自己的脚步在走,确实在云服务器市场上有自己的立足之地。我们看看过去一年中Linode的成就:第一、承诺投入 100,000 美元来帮助具有社会意识的非营利组织,促进有价值的革新。第二、发...
ShockHosting商家在前面文章中有介绍过几次。ShockHosting商家成立于2013年的美国主机商,目前主要提供虚拟主机、VPS主机、独立服务器和域名注册等综合IDC业务,现有美国洛杉矶、新泽西、芝加哥、达拉斯、荷兰阿姆斯特丹、英国和澳大利亚悉尼七大数据中心。这次有新增日本东京机房。而且同时有推出5折优惠促销,而且即刻使用支付宝下单的话还可获赠10美金的账户信用额度,折扣相比之前的常规...
WHloud Date(鲸云数据),原做大数据和软件开发的团队,现在转变成云计算服务,面对海内外用户提供中国大陆,韩国,日本,香港等多个地方节点服务。24*7小时的在线支持,较为全面的虚拟化构架以及全方面的技术支持!官方网站:https://www.whloud.com/WHloud Date 韩国BGP云主机少量补货随时可以开通,随时可以用,两小时内提交退款,可在工作日期间全额原路返回!支持pa...